    South Africa s long-span bridge

    The Mtentu Bridge is a multi span box girder bridge, currently under construction, spanning the Mtentu River, near Lundini in the Eastern Cape of South Africa. The Mtentu Bridge forms part of the N2 Wild Coast road (N2WC) project, which aims to improve the travel time between Durban and East London. Mtentu Bridge is scheduled to open as the highest bridge ever built in Africa with a deck height of approximately 223 meters. The massive central beam span of 260 meters will also be a record for the African continent among beam bridges and the 141 meter pier #9 will be also be the tallest on the. This project involves the construction of new road infrastructure to improve the transport link between the Eastern Cape and KwaZulu-Natal Provinces in South Africa The South African National Roads Agency Limited (SANRAL) is responsible for the implementation of this project. Its 260-meter main span will rank among the world's longest balanced cantilever designs. Imagine that stretching across a gorge near Lundini, a speck on the map that's now a construction hotspot.

    Bridge with a circular bridge structure

    The Laguna Garzón Bridge , located in Uruguay, is a bridge famous for its unusual circular shape. Most bridges are pretty straight forward, but this one is making heads turn 'round. Connecting Rocha Department and Maldonado Department. It's one of the most spectacular bridges in the world. One such atypical bridge can be found on the Uruguayan Atlantic coast, across the Garzón Lagoon, on the border between the Maldonado and Rocha departments: the. Though this bridge is circular, this isn't a roundabout we're talking about – it has two semi-circular halves, each with a one-way road and held up by round concrete pillars. Its purpose was to allow drivers to cross the lagoon smoothly; previously, they had to do so using motorized rafts. Unlike many purely. The bridge's unusual circular road deck slow traffic and allows drivers, pedestrians, and cyclists to appreciate panoramic views to one of the most beautiful and pristine coastal landscapes in Uruguay.
